Transcription: You can gain access to the Internet through libraries, community colleges, universities, or your employer. You can also use an online service or an Internet Service Provider, usually known as an ISP. An online service provides Internet access as well as additional services. An Internet Service Provider provides only Internet access. The ISP can be a local or national provider. If you are using an ISP, you should make sure they provide you with a local access number so you won't have to pay long distance phone charges.
